Toronto Blue Jays at Minnesota Twins 8/7/22 - MLB Picks & Predictions

The Toronto Blue Jays conclude a four-game series on the road Sunday against the Minnesota Twins. Toronto is 59-47 following its 6-5 loss to the Twins Friday in the second game of the series. The Blue Jays have won four of the last six and are second in the American League East, 10 ½ games behind the first-place New York Yankees.

Lourdes Gurriel Jr is batting .312 to lead Toronto while Alejandro Kirk is the leader in on-base percentage at .386. Vladimir Guerrero Jr has 23 home runs, 68 RBIs and 116 hits to lead Toronto in each category. On Sunday, the Toronto Blue Jays will send Kevin Gausman to the mound. The right-hander is 8-8 with a 3.06 ERA, 132 Ks and 20 BBs.

Minnesota improved to 56-50 following its one-run victory over Toronto on Friday. Nick Gordon belted a three-run home run and scored the winning run during the 10th inning after a pair of errors by Toronto. Minnesota has won two out of the last three. The Twins are first in the American League Central, two games in front of both Cleveland and Chicago.

First baseman Luis Arraez is batting .321 to lead Minnesota and has team highs in hits with 114 and on-base percentage at .389. Center fielder Byron Buxton is the leader in home runs with 26 and second baseman Jorge Polanco is the leader in RBIs with 49. On Sunday, the Minnesota Twins will send Chris Archer to the mound. The right-hander is 2-5 with a 4.05 ERA, 62 Ks and 40 BBs.

Toronto has won 32 of the last 47 versus the Twins played in Minnesota. Toronto starter Kevin Gausman is coming off a strong outing in which the right-hander allowed no runs on one hit across eight Innings including 10 strikeouts and one walk resulting in a 3-1 victory over Tampa Bay. Minnesota has lost each of Chris Archer's last four starts and over that span the right-hander has issued 16 walks over the last 16 innings. Final Score Prediction, Toronto Blue Jays win 6-3.
